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al
Catching slab leaks early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a slab leak, especially if they’re accompanied by warping or buckling of the surrounding area.
Unusual Noises or Vibrations
If you hear strange noises or feel vibrations coming from your floors or walls, it could be a sign of a slab leak.
High Water Bills
If your water bills are suddenly higher than usual, it could be a sign of a slab leak.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it could be a sign of a slab leak.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age, such as puddles or pools of water, is a clear sign of a slab leak.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in Hackberry, TX
The cost of slab leak water removal in Hackberry, TX can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and diagnosis | $100 – $500 | Severity of the leak, complexity of the repair |
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area, amount of water present |
| Repair and repl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of the leak, complexity of the repair |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area, level of contamination |
| Follow-up and inspection | $100 – $500 | Severity of the leak, complexity of the repair |
